The Deputy Speaker of the House of Representatives, Benjamin Kalu has commended the vast influence of Sir Emeka Offor across key sectors of Nigeria’s economy, including oil and gas, power, logistics, and telecommunications.

 

In a congratulatory message marking Offor’s 66th birthday, Kalu lauded the philanthropist’s unwavering commitment on social impact, particularly through the Dr. Emeka Offor Foundation (SEOF).

 

He emphasised the foundation’s transformative role in education, healthcare, and youth empowerment, which has uplifted lives in Nigeria and beyond.

 

Recognising Offor’s dedication to national unity, Kalu recalled his pivotal support for the Peace in South East Project (PISE-P), an initiative launched in December 2023 to restore peace in the region through non-kinetic measures.

The traditional ruler noted that at the heart of Sir Emeka Offor’s humanitarian impact lies the Sir Emeka Offor Foundation (SEOF), a non-governmental, not-for-profit organisation he founded to alleviate human suffering and uplift underserved populations.

 

SEOF has become a cornerstone of his legacy, embodying his philosophy that wealth and success come with the responsibility to improve the lives of others.

 

” The foundation, since its inception, has touched numerous sectors, including education, healthcare, youth empowerment, and poverty alleviation. Through his foundation’s work, Sir Emeka Offor has established himself as a leading light in philanthropy, particularly within Nigeria and Africa.”

 

Personal empowerment

He also stressed that the celebrant believes fervently in education and its transformative power, not only as a tool for personal empowerment but also as a vehicle for societal change.

 

Through the foundation’s Education Program, thousands of students have received scholarships, school supplies, and other resources to help them pursue their dreams.

 

“Perhaps even more impactful is SEOF’s partnership with international organisations such as Rotary International to distribute millions of books, instructional materials, and computers to schools and libraries across Nigeria and Africa. These efforts are addressing critical gaps in access to quality educational resources, particularly in underserved communities.
